I am only 15, but Shirley Jones has been my all time heroine ever since I saw her in "Carousel." This collection of songs (mostly duets with her husband Jack Cassidy, who she fell in love with during the European tour of "Oklahoma!") mainly come from operettas and early musical comedies, the composers including Jerome Kern, George Gershwin and Irving Berlin. The oldest song, "Kiss Me Again" is almost 100 years old now, but they are all as lovely and fresh as ever. They are perfect for Shirley's beautiful, clear soprano voice. My highlights are the duets "You are Love" from "Show Boat," "Cheek to Cheek" from "Top Hat" and Shirley's solo, the beautiful ballad "It Might as Well be Spring" from "State Fair." If you liked Shirley's singing in "Oklahoma!" and "Carousel," you'll love this. This album is a gem.
